:root{--color-collection-header-bg: 47, 47, 49;--color-collection-header-text: 245, 241, 234}.custom-collection-header-text{background-color:rgb(var(--color-collection-header-bg));padding-top:var(--custom-collection-header-text-padding-top-mobile);padding-bottom:var(--custom-collection-header-text-padding-bottom-mobile)}.custom-collection-header-text .page-width{max-width:140rem}.custom-collection-header-text__header{text-align:center;max-width:86rem;margin:0 auto 2.8rem}.custom-collection-header-text__heading{color:rgb(var(--color-collection-header-text));margin:0}.custom-collection-header-text__subheading{color:rgb(var(--color-collection-header-text));margin:1rem auto 0;font-size:1.4rem;line-height:1.5}.custom-collection-header-text__grid{margin:0;row-gap:1.6rem;column-gap:2.4rem;display:grid;grid-template-columns:repeat(4,minmax(0,1fr))}.custom-collection-header-text__item{list-style:none;max-width:none;width:auto}.custom-collection-header-text__media-link{display:block;text-decoration:none}.custom-collection-header-text__image-wrap{position:relative;aspect-ratio:1 / .85;overflow:hidden;background:#ffffff12}.custom-collection-header-text__image{width:100%;height:100%;display:block;object-fit:cover}.custom-collection-header-text__label{margin-top:1.4rem;display:block;text-align:center;color:rgb(var(--color-collection-header-text));font-size:2rem;line-height:1.2}@media screen and (min-width:750px){.custom-collection-header-text{padding-top:var(--custom-collection-header-text-padding-top-desktop);padding-bottom:var(--custom-collection-header-text-padding-bottom-desktop)}}@media screen and (max-width:989px){.custom-collection-header-text__grid{grid-template-columns:repeat(2,minmax(0,1fr))}.custom-collection-header-text__label{font-size:1.8rem}}@media screen and (max-width:749px){.custom-collection-header-text .page-width{padding-left:2rem;padding-right:2rem}.custom-collection-header-text__header{margin-bottom:2rem}.custom-collection-header-text__subheading{font-size:1.3rem}.custom-collection-header-text__grid{grid-template-columns:minmax(0,1fr);row-gap:1.2rem;column-gap:1.2rem}.custom-collection-header-text__label{margin-top:.8rem;font-size:1.5rem}}
/*# sourceMappingURL=/cdn/shop/t/4/assets/custom-collection-header-text.css.map */
